Originally Posted by MikeyC,Oct 10 2007, 08:25 PM
What products/process did you use. You mentioned that you used a rotary . . . which one?
A makita rotary..

All meguiars products (im a meguiars products lover)
I used
Wool Pad (probully wasn't necessary but I used anyways)
Cutting Pad
Soft Buff Pad
Finishing Pad
Medium Cutting Compound
Swirl Remover 2.0 Compound
Machine Glaze
Show Car Glaze
Meguiars Yellow Wax
